Abstract

The invention discloses municipal dust removal and floor sweeping equipment, which belongs to the technical field of dust removal devices and comprises a garbage can, a storage box and a water tank, wherein the garbage can is arranged above the storage box, the left side of the garbage can is connected with the water tank, the top of the garbage can is provided with a vacuum pump, a dust removal chamber is arranged in the garbage can, the top of the dust removal chamber is provided with an air pipe connected with the vacuum pump, the bottom of the air pipe is connected with a dust collection nozzle, and the outer side of the dust collection nozzle is. The device has strong dust collecting capacity, collected dust can be better concentrated, dust particles in the air can be effectively separated, the probability of secondary pollution is reduced, the cleaning area is large, and the device is suitable for various ground conditions.

Description

A equipment of sweeping floor that removes dust for municipal administration
Technical Field
The invention belongs to the technical field of cleaning equipment, and particularly relates to municipal dust removal and sweeping equipment.
Background
The road surface cleaning equipment in China develops from a single pure cleaning type to various types after decades of development, the product performance and the product quality are rapidly improved, and particularly after the development of innovation, the product performance and the reliability of the sweeper truck are greatly improved by importing key outsourcing parts. However, the level of the road sweeper in China at present is still a certain gap compared with that of developed countries abroad, particularly, in the aspect of product reliability, along with the development and progress of society, the road sweeper does not meet the requirement of a simple dust sweeper any more, and more requirements are provided from the aspects of multifunction, environmental protection, economy and the like, and the market calls municipal road surface cleaning equipment capable of meeting various requirements.

Disclosure of Invention
The invention aims to provide a municipal dust removal sweeping device which is strong in dust collection capacity, can collect dust better in a centralized manner, can effectively separate dust particles in air, reduces the probability of secondary pollution, is large in sweeping area, and is suitable for various ground conditions.
The technical scheme adopted by the invention for realizing the purpose is as follows: a dust removal equipment of sweeping floor for municipal administration, including dustbin, storage case, water tank, the storage case top is equipped with the dustbin, and the water tank is connected on the left of the dustbin, and the dustbin top is equipped with the vacuum pump, and the inside clean room that is equipped with of dustbin, clean room top are equipped with the trachea with vacuum pump connection, and the dust absorption mouth is connected to the trachea bottom, and the parcel has the gauze in the dust absorption mouth outside. Example 2:
in the practical use process of the municipal dust removal sweeping equipment, the vacuum pump 2 is started, strong negative pressure can be generated in the dust removal box 22, the plastic sheet 282 at the right end of the dust removal plug 28 can be separated from the body of the dust removal plug 28 due to the influence of the negative pressure to generate a gap with a certain distance, the device is pushed to move forwards, the sweeping wheel 24 is used for removing stains which are stubborn on the ground, the sponge brush 246 movably connected to the bottom of the sweeping wheel 24 can be added with a cleaning agent when needed so as to be convenient for decontamination, the sweeping rod 23 can work along with the traveling wheel 12 at the same time, the brush on the surface of the sweeping rod 23 is in direct contact with the ground, dust can be swept onto the conveying belt in the storage box 10 through the brush, the guide plate 11 is obliquely arranged to facilitate the dust to enter the storage box 10, the partition plate 20 on the conveying belt 21 can be circulated in a reciprocating manner, and the swept dust can stay on the partition, the dust can be inhaled in the clean room 22 when conveying near dust removal end cap 28, the dust of inhaling in the clean room 22 can billow everywhere under normal conditions, the liquid water 32 of depositing in the clean room 22, pivot 19 in the clean room 22 can drive puddler 31 rotatory under the drive of motor 4, utilize the inertial collision of water droplet and dust particle can be effectual with the dust particle separation in the air during rotation, make the particle in the dust can sink in the bottom, further processing has been made to the dust, the secondary pollution of dust has been avoided completely, ground clearance also cleaner.
Example 3:
the side wall of the left side of the dust removal chamber is provided with the dust removal plug, and the data measured in the table can show that when the vacuum suction force is 1900mmH2O, the separation distance between the dust removal plug and the arc-shaped sheet is the optimal separation distance within 6cm-10cm, dust can be effectively sucked into the dust removal box within the distance, the dust cannot flow back, the secondary pollution of the dust is completely avoided, and the energy consumption of equipment is reduced.
